Origins and Family

Vladimir Kim was born in Myrzakent[2]. He was born on +1960-10-29T00:00:00Z[3].

Education

Vladimir Kim's education included a stint at Kazakh Leading Academy of Architecture and Construction[10].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include business executive[4] and business oligarch[5]. Employers include KAZ Minerals[8], a business[24], in United Kingdom[25], founded in 1930[26], headquartered in London[27] and Kazakhmys[9], a business[28], in Kazakhstan[29], founded in 1992[30], headquartered in London[31].

Recognition

Awards received include Order of Holy Prince Daniel of Moscow 2nd class[11], a grade of an order[32], in Russia[33]; Order of Kurmet[12], an order[34], in Kazakhstan[35], founded in 1993[36]; Order of Nazarbayev[13], an order[37], in Kazakhstan[38], founded in 2001[39]; and Order of the Leopard[14], an order[40], in Kazakhstan[41], founded in 1999[42].
